PG电子接入指南,从入门到高级操作pg电子怎么接入
本文目录导读:
随着智能设备和物联网技术的普及,PG电子的接入已经成为许多开发者和工程师的重要任务,无论是智能家居设备、工业自动化系统,还是实验室设备,PG电子的接入都扮演着关键角色,本文将从基础到高级,详细介绍如何顺利实现PG电子的接入。
硬件准备
1 硬件清单
要实现PG电子的接入,首先需要准备以下硬件设备:
- 网络适配器:支持Wi-Fi或以太网的无线或 wired 适配器。
- 网线:用于连接设备的网络线缆。
- 电源适配器:为设备提供稳定的电力供应。
- 开发板或PC:用于运行控制软件的设备。
- 软件开发环境:如编程语言(Python、C++等)、开发工具(如VS Code、PyCharm)等。
2 硬件选择建议
选择合适的硬件设备对于确保网络通信的稳定性和安全性至关重要,以下是一些推荐:
- 无线网络适配器:无线网络适配器具有便携性和灵活性,适合移动开发环境。
- 以太网适配器:如果需要在固定位置稳定连接,则以太网适配器是更好的选择。
- 电源适配器:选择具有高功率输出的电源适配器,以确保设备长时间运行。
- 开发板:选择支持PG标准的开发板,如Raspberry Pi、Arduino等。
软件安装
1 Windows用户
1.1 下载网络适配器驱动
- 下载驱动:从官方或可信来源下载与网络适配器型号匹配的驱动程序。
- 安装驱动:通过设备管理器或控制面板进行安装。
1.2 安装网络适配器
- 启用设备管理器:右键点击“此电脑”,选择“管理”。
- 展开“设备管理器”。
- 找到对应的网络适配器,右键选择“更新驱动程序”。
- 选择自动检测或手动选择驱动程序。
2 macOS用户
2.1 下载网络适配器驱动
- 下载驱动:从官方或可信来源下载与网络适配器型号匹配的驱动程序。
- 安装驱动:通过“应用程序” > “实用工具” > “安装软件”进行安装。
2.2 安装网络适配器
- 启用设备管理器:右键点击“此电脑”,选择“管理”。
- 展开“设备管理器”。
- 找到对应的网络适配器,右键选择“更新驱动程序”。
- 选择自动检测或手动选择驱动程序。
3 编程语言安装
为了实现PG电子的接入,编程语言是必不可少的工具,以下是几种常用编程语言及其安装方法:
3.1 Python
- 下载Python:从Python官网下载安装包。
- 安装:选择合适的版本(如3.x),按照提示完成安装。
3.2 C++
- 下载编译器:从GNU Compiler Collection (GCC)下载安装包。
- 安装:按照安装说明配置环境变量,完成安装。
基本操作
1 串口通信
串口通信是实现PG电子接入最常用的方法之一,以下是通过串口实现通信的步骤:
1.1 确定设备端口
根据PG电子的规格,确定需要使用的串口端口,串口端口为COM1、COM2等。
1.2 编写通信命令
编写简单的串口通信命令,例如发送“Hello, World!”到目标设备。
import serial ser = serial.Serial('COM1', 9600) # 替换为实际端口 ser.write(b'Hello, World!\r\n') ser.close()
1.3 测试通信
在目标设备上运行串口工具(如TCPIP),检查是否接收到正确的通信命令。
2 USB通信
通过USB通信实现PG电子接入也是一种高效的方式,以下是使用USB通信的步骤:
2.1 设置USB端口
在目标设备上找到与PG电子连接的USB端口,并记录其驱动程序路径。
2.2 编写USB通信命令
使用编程语言编写USB通信命令,例如发送数据包到目标设备。
import pyserial ser = pyserial.Serial('COM3', 9600) # 替换为实际端口 ser.write(b'Hello, World!\r\n') ser.close()
2.3 测试通信
在目标设备上运行USB工具,检查是否接收到正确的通信命令。
高级配置
1 动态IP配置
对于需要远程控制和管理的PG电子设备,动态IP配置是必不可少的。
1.1 配置动态IP
- 打开设备管理器:右键点击“此电脑”,选择“管理”。
- 展开“网络适配器”。
- 右键选择“更新驱动程序”。
- 选择自动检测或手动选择驱动程序。
- 确保设备连接到Wi-Fi网络。
1.2 设置动态IP
- 打开网络和互联网设置:右键点击“此电脑”,选择“网络和互联网”。
- 展开“网络和互联网”。
- 找到“以太网”或“Wi-Fi”设置。
- 点击“属性”。
- 在“网络选项”中,选择“自动获取网络地址”。
- 点击“高级网络设置”。
- 在“动态IP配置”部分,选择“手动指定IP地址”。
- 输入所需的IP地址、子网掩码和网关地址。
- 点击“应用”。
- 点击“确定”。
2 高级通信协议
对于一些复杂的PG电子接入需求,可能需要使用高级通信协议,如HTTP/HTTPS。
2.1 配置HTTP服务器
- 安装HTTP服务器:使用如Apache、Nginx等HTTP服务器。
- 配置服务器:配置服务器绑定到特定端口,并允许客户端连接。
- 编写HTTP服务器代码:使用编程语言编写简单的HTTP服务器,例如使用Python的
http.server
模块。
2.2 使用HTTP客户端
- 编写HTTP客户端:使用编程语言编写简单的HTTP客户端,例如使用Python的
requests
库。 - 发送HTTP请求:发送GET或POST请求到目标设备的HTTP端点。
注意事项
在实现PG电子接入的过程中,需要注意以下几点:
1 硬件兼容性
确保硬件设备之间的兼容性,避免因硬件不兼容导致通信失败。
2 网络配置
仔细配置网络参数,确保设备能够正常通信。
3 安全问题
注意设备的网络安全性,防止遭受网络攻击。
4 能源管理
确保设备在运行过程中能够保持稳定的电力供应,避免因电源问题导致通信中断。
通过本文的详细指南,相信你已经掌握了PG电子接入的基本方法和高级配置技巧,无论是简单的串口通信,还是复杂的动态IP配置和高级通信协议,都能通过本文的步骤顺利实现,希望本文能为你提供有价值的信息,帮助你在PG电子接入的道路上少走弯路。
PG电子接入指南,从入门到高级操作pg电子怎么接入,
发表评论